Jin Liqun (Chinese: 金立群; born 1949) is Chairman of Board of Supervisors of the sovereign wealth fund, China Investment Corporation, and its subsidiary Central Huijin Investment Ltd.. He is the Secretary General of the Multilateral Interim Secretariat of Asian Infrastructure Investment Bank (AIIB).[1] He is also serving as deputy chair of the International Working Group of Sovereign Wealth Funds.[2] He was formerly the Vice-President of the Asian Development Bank, and Vice Minister of Finance of the People's Republic of China.[3]

Biography

Jin Liqun was appointed as the Secretary General of the Multilateral Interim Secretariat of Asian Infrastructure Investment Bank (AIIB) in October, 2014.[1]

Jin Liqun was Vice President (Operations 1) of the Asian Development Bank (ADB). Before joining the ADB in August 2003, he served as Vice Minister of Finance, Director General of the World Bank Department at the Ministry of Finance, and Alternative Executive Director of China to the World Bank Group. He was a member of the Monetary Policy Committee of the People’s Bank of China.

Jin holds a master’s degree from Beijing Foreign Studies University and was a Hubert Humphrey Fellow in the Economics Graduate Program at Boston University.[4]
